With so many older individuals repeatedly taking part in, pickleball accidents have been on the rise amongst this inhabitants.
“Ninety-two % of those fractures have been attributed to falls throughout pickleball gameplay,” says Yasmine Ghattas, a research writer and fourth 12 months medical pupil on the College of Central Florida Faculty of Drugs in Orlando. “I feel for many who understand pickleball to be fully benign, this research definitely exhibits that the sport has its fair proportion of threat of damage, together with fractures.”
Ladies Extra Vulnerable to Pickleball Harm, however Males Are Extra Typically Hospitalized
Utilizing knowledge from the Client Product Security Fee’s Nationwide Digital Harm Surveillance System (NEISS), Ghattas and her collaborators recognized 377 people with pickleball-related accidents between 2002 and 2020.
Primarily based on evaluation of the information pattern, the researchers calculated a 90-fold rise in pickleball associated fractures over the research interval, with a noticeable surge from 2020 onward, when fractures doubled.
In translating the numbers to replicate all the U.S. inhabitants, Ghattas and her crew calculated that nationwide there have been about 24,000 fractures over the course of the research and 5,400 over the last 12 months.
About two-thirds of all fractures have been within the arms, shoulders, or palms, and most fractures have been in girls ages 65 and up, probably reflecting diminishing bone well being after menopause.
Even if girls sustained nearly all of fractures, males have been 2.3 occasions extra more likely to be hospitalized following a pickleball fracture. The research authors speculated that this development might have been due, partially, to the severity of fractures amongst males. Their accidents typically included fractures of the hip and femur (thigh bone).
Ghattas acknowledged that the outcomes have been restricted by the small pattern dimension. “The NEISS database was solely consultant of about 1.7 % of nationwide pickleball-related fractures,” she says.
Why Are Older Pickleball Gamers Getting Extra Fractures?
Whereas the research authors counsel that the rise in accidents is said to the recognition of the game, the “knowledge simply is not there to inform us if the game’s recognition is the only motive behind the rise,” based on Ghattas.
Michael Fredricson, MD, director of Bodily Drugs and Rehabilitation Sports activities Drugs at Stanford College in California and co-director of the Stanford Longevity Middle, says the hovering numbers will not be surprising, as many older individuals engaged within the sport are liable to fracture.
“On this older inhabitants, your bones will not be as robust as once you have been youthful — they’re beginning to skinny,” says Dr. Fredricson. “It is suspected that loads of these fractures have been associated to underlying osteoporosis,” a illness that weakens bones.
On the identical time, nevertheless, he stresses that train like this may be useful for bone density, and the actions concerned might enhance steadiness, decreasing the danger of falls.
General, Fredricson believes the advantages of pickleball outweigh the dangers if older adults proceed with some warning. As a result of the sport is comparatively simple to study, some older adults might begin taking part in even when they haven’t been very bodily lively not too long ago.
“I would not simply soar onto the pickleball courtroom if you have not been exercising in any respect.” he says. Fredricson advises getting some degree of bodily conditioning earlier than becoming a member of in, like using a stationary bike or some kind of cross coaching exercise to construct power, steadiness, and cardio capability.
Coaching may assist stop different pickleball-related accidents, akin to strains, sprains, bruises, scrapes, and decrease again ache.
Ghattas emphasised that the research is just not meant to discourage anybody from taking part in pickleball, however she advises older adults to seek the advice of with their healthcare supplier to make educated choices concerning their participation.
